Description

One stop customized web pages that allow users to pick the content that is displayed by choosing modules. (e.g. viewing email, calendar, news feeds and sports scores all on one page).

 

Uses and Potential Benefits

Useful as a web browser home page or reference page, can place needed information all in one place.  Example: a foundation might set up a web portal for its program officers to highlight useful information (news, email, calendar) all on one place.
